How much do global labeling j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for global labeling in Ohio is $29.02,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.44 and $37.26 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a global labeling?

A Global Labeling job involves managing the development, updates, and compliance of product labeling for pharmaceutical, biotech, or medical device companies. Professionals in this role ensure that labeling documents, including package inserts and safety information, align with global regulatory requirements. They collaborate with cross-functional teams, including regulatory affairs, medical, and legal departments, to maintain accuracy and consistency. Global Labeling specialists also track regulatory changes and implement updates to ensure compliance in different markets.

What are the main responsibilities of a global labeling professional on a day-to-day basis?

On a typical day, a Global Labeling professional coordinates the development, review, and maintenance of product labeling to ensure compliance with varying international regulations. This often involves collaborating closely with cross-functional teams such as regulatory affairs, medical writing, marketing, and quality assurance to gather and validate product information. They also manage updates to labeling documents, monitor regulatory changes in target markets, and prepare submissions for regulatory agencies. The role requires balancing the accuracy and clarity of labeling content while managing multiple projects and tight deadlines.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the global labeling position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Global Labeling professional, you typically need a background in life sciences, regulatory affairs, or pharmaceuticals, coupled with a thorough understanding of international labeling requirements and product regulations. Familiarity with regulatory databases, document management systems, and certifications such as RAC (Regulatory Affairs Certification) are highly beneficial. Exceptional attention to detail, strong organizational abilities, and clear cross-cultural communication skills set candidates apart in this role. These competencies are crucial for ensuring compliant and timely product labeling across global markets, reducing risks and supporting successful product launches.

Job Title: Global Quality Specialist
The Impact You'll Make
In this role, you are the crucial link between our global quality vision and our manufacturing sites. You will be at the forefront of ensuring excellence for our innovative Data Center Liquid Cooling (DCLC) products, a technology critical to the future of data infrastructure.
This is your opportunity to drive alignment and best practices on a global scale. You will not just follow standards; you will help create and implement them, ensuring consistency and reliability across multiple plants. Your work will directly reduce quality issues and elevate our product performance.
Your expertise will empower our teams, strengthen our quality systems, and ensure our customers receive the world-class products they expect from Danfoss. If you are ready to make a tangible impact on a global scale, this is your chance.
What You'll Be Doing
As a Global Quality Specialist, you will be a central driver of our quality culture. You will have the opportunity to:
  • Serve as the key quality expert for our manufacturing sites, driving alignment with global standards and strategies.
  • Champion process standardization across all plants, implementing best practices for inspection, testing, and containment.
  • Lead cross-functional problem-solving using structured methods like 8D and 5-Why to identify root causes and prevent future issues.
  • Use your analytical skills to monitor key quality metrics, turning data into actions that reduce defects and improve customer satisfaction.
  • Play a vital role in new product launches by ensuring manufacturing readiness and supporting customer quality activities, including PPAP submissions.

What We're Looking For
We are looking for a quality leader with a passion for driving improvement in a global manufacturing environment. The ideal candidate will have:
  • A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Quality, or a related technical field.
  • 5+ years of experience in a manufacturing, customer, or supplier quality role.
  • Deep expertise in quality systems (ISO/IATF), structured problem-solving (8D, 5-Why), and core quality tools (PPAP, NPD).
  • A proven ability to drive standardization and coordinate improvements across multiple manufacturing sites.
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ills, with a willingness to travel globally as needed.
